简体中文简体中文
EnglishEnglish
简体中文简体中文

深入解析图片的HTML源码:从代码到视觉呈现

2025-01-19 09:40:09

在互联网的世界中,图片是传达信息、美化页面、增强用户体验的重要元素。而图片的HTML源码,则是将图片嵌入网页的基石。本文将深入解析图片的HTML源码,从其结构到功能,帮助读者全面了解图片在网页中的呈现过程。

一、图片HTML源码的基本结构

图片的HTML源码主要由以下部分组成:

1.<img> 标签:这是嵌入图片的基本标签,用于在网页中显示图片。

2.src 属性:指定图片的路径,即图片的URL。

3.alt 属性:提供图片的替代文本,当图片无法加载或被禁用时,浏览器会显示此文本。

4.其他可选属性:如 widthheighttitleborder 等,用于设置图片的尺寸、边框、标题等。

以下是一个简单的图片HTML源码示例:

html <img src="example.jpg" alt="示例图片" width="100" height="100">

二、图片路径与URL

<img> 标签的 src 属性中,我们需要指定图片的路径。图片路径可以是相对路径或绝对路径。

1.相对路径:相对于当前页面的路径。例如,如果图片位于当前页面的同一目录下,则路径为 example.jpg;如果图片位于当前页面的子目录下,则路径为 subdir/example.jpg

2.绝对路径:从服务器根目录开始的路径。例如,如果图片位于服务器根目录下的 images 目录中,则路径为 /images/example.jpg

三、图片的替代文本(alt)

alt 属性为图片提供替代文本,这对于搜索引擎优化(SEO)和屏幕阅读器等辅助工具非常重要。当图片无法加载或被禁用时,浏览器会显示 alt 属性中的文本。合理设置 alt 属性,有助于提高网页的可访问性和用户体验。

四、图片的尺寸与属性

<img> 标签中,我们可以通过 widthheight 属性设置图片的尺寸。需要注意的是,设置图片尺寸时,应尽量保持图片的原始比例,以免图片变形。

此外,其他可选属性如 titleborder 等,可以根据实际需求进行设置。例如,title 属性可以为图片添加标题,当鼠标悬停在图片上时显示。

五、图片的加载与优化

1.图片加载:当浏览器解析到 <img> 标签时,会向服务器发送请求,加载图片。加载过程中,图片可能出现在页面上,也可能先不显示,直到加载完成。

2.图片优化:为了提高网页加载速度和用户体验,可以对图片进行优化。常见的优化方法包括:

  • 压缩图片:减小图片文件大小,提高加载速度。
  • 使用合适的图片格式:根据图片类型选择合适的格式,如 JPEG、PNG、GIF 等。
  • 使用CDN加速:通过内容分发网络(CDN)加速图片加载,提高访问速度。

六、总结

图片的HTML源码是网页中展示图片的基础。了解图片源码的结构、路径、属性和优化方法,有助于我们更好地利用图片提升网页质量。在今后的网页设计和开发中,让我们关注图片的HTML源码,为用户提供更加美观、实用的网页体验。